Warehouse and Factory Floor Marking in Leeston

Leeston and the Ellesmere plains have strong dairy and cropping activity, with milk-tanker loading bays, cool stores, seed-store depots, farm-machinery sales and service yards, and rural engineering all part of the rhythm. Floor marking is food-safe epoxy for standard dairy shed and cool-store areas, with anti-slip for wet zones and milk-loading aprons, and MMA cold plastic where heavy-vehicle traffic would wear paint off. We induct onto dairy sites and book work into dry-off or between-milking windows.

Leeston warehouses FAQ

Can you do dairy shed floor marking?

Yes. Food-safe, anti-slip coatings are the standard finish for Ellesmere plains dairy sheds and milk tanker loading bays. We induct onto site and work under the milk-quality plan so the cows can step back onto fresh marking once it cures.

Can you work around a live operation?

Yes. Dairy shed work is scheduled into dry-off or between-milking windows, so day-to-day farm operations can continue. For cool stores and packing sheds, weekend or planned shutdown windows are the usual fit.

Specialist and Industrial Marking in Leeston

Line removal, anti-slip for Ellesmere dairy ramps and milk-tanker loading bays, cold plastic for heavy-vehicle and cropping transport yards, and helipad marking for rural emergency pads dotted across the plains all fall under specialist work. Grinding and water blasting lift old paint from chip seal without damaging the rural road surface. Cold plastic stands up to the heavy haulage moving grain and stock feed across the Ellesmere network in the shoulder and peak seasons.

Leeston specialist FAQ

Can you remove old lines without damaging the seal underneath?

Yes. Low-pressure grinding and water blasting are the standard methods for Leeston High Street and the showground lot, which lifts worn paint without damaging chip seal or asphalt. Chemical removal is reserved for concrete dairy shed floors where a clean edge matters.

How much does line marking cost in Leeston?

Leeston prices sit in line with rural Selwyn and the wider Ellesmere plains. A 30-bay High Street or Ellesmere A&P showgrounds re-mark generally runs $1,500 to $3,500 plus GST, with rural travel included within the Southbridge, Doyleston, and Springston catchment.
